Legato tonguing on the saxophone involves lightly touching the very tip of the reed with the tip of the mid section of your tongue. Be sure to not touch the flat of the reed, but the edge where the mouthpiece and reed touch while in vibration. When done correctly, you achieve a very pleasant and mature legato attack.
